Course Details


• Unit 1: Understanding Colonialism and its Impact on Education
• Unit 2: Decolonizing Curriculum: An Overview
• Unit 3: Historical Resistance Movements Against Colonial Education
• Unit 4: Contemporary Anti-Colonial Resistance Movements in Education
• Unit 5: Critical Pedagogy and Anti-Colonial Curriculum
• Unit 6: Indigenous Knowledge and Anti-Colonial Curriculum
• Unit 7: Inclusive Teaching Strategies in Anti-Colonial Curriculum
• Unit 8: Assessment and Evaluation in Anti-Colonial Curriculum
• Unit 9: Building and Sustaining Anti-Colonial Learning Communities
• Unit 10: Policy and Advocacy for Anti-Colonial Curriculum
